Page 227 - Tự Học Xửa Chữa Và Nâng Cấp Máy Vi Tính
P. 227

đệm  sử dụng một phương pháp gọi là LRU (Least Rerently
   ưsed  -  lâu  không được  sử  dụng nhất)  làm  phương pháp cơ
   sỏ  cho  quản  lý  vùng  đệm.  Dữ  liệu  nào  nằm  lâu  nhất  mà
   không được sử dụng sẽ bị đẩy ra giải phóng chổ cho dữ liệu
   khác vừa được sử dụng mả chưa ỏ trong vùng đệm.
       Càng nhiều  file  được trao  đổi với vùng đệm.  thì chương
   trình  phải  quyết  định  càng  nhiều  cách  thức  sử  dụng  tốt
   nhất không gian nhố cho phép.  Và càng sử dụng đến vùng
   đệm thì càng chứng tỏ hiệu quả.

       Những  chương  trình  cache  đơn  giản  nhất  như
   SMARTDRV  chỉ  đơn  thuần  là  lấp  các  chổ  vừa  mới  giải
   phóng  bằng  dữ  liệu  kê  tiếp  trên  đĩa.  Nhưng  với  những bộ
   chương  trình  tân  tiến  hơn  như  Norton  Speedcache+  và
   Super  PC-Kwik  thực  sự  còn  gần  "trí  tuệ  nhân  tạo"  thông
   thái,  chuẩn  đoán  trước  về những  dữ liệu  bạn  sẽ  cần  trong
   lần  gọi  kế tiếp.  Tất  cả  điều  đó  xảy  ra  tự  động,  bên  trong
   mà không cần bạn phải làm gì cả.
         Các  chương  trình  tiện  ích  cache  thực  hiện  các  công
   việc  của  mình  khi  bộ  xử  lý  rảnh  roi,  ví  dụ  giữa  các  lần
   nhấn phím,  hoặc  khi bạn đang viết  một văn bản.  Mỗi  một
   nhà  sản xuất chương trình  cache  cất giữ cẩn  thận phương
   pháp của riêng mình về quản lý bộ đệm như cửa hàng bán
   đồ ăn nhanh thủ bí quyết pha chê gia vị.

       Đoc nhanh, gh i nhanh
       Đến  đây,  chúng ta  đã  thâV rõ các  lợi  điểm  của  bộ  đệm
   đê  đọc dữ liệu  từ đĩa cứng.  Nhưng điều  gặp  phải hiện thòi
   của  các  chương  trình  tiện  ích  cache  còn  theo  cả  một  cách
   khác.  Cách  ghi  có  vùng  đệm  được  biết  đến  như  các  tên
   khác như Lazy writes (ghi lười), ghi sau...
       Bình thường,  khi cất một file hoặc đóng một ứng dụng,
   bạn nhận thấy được một sự chậm trễ trong khi đó đĩa cứng


                                                                 227
   222   223   224   225   226   227   228   229   230   231   232